About Coon Rapids, IA's

Coon Rapids is a small city located in Carroll County, Iowa, United States. Established in the late 19th century, it has a rich history tied to the development of the railroad and agriculture in the region. The city is nestled along the Middle Raccoon River, which has been a significant factor in shaping its development and local culture. Coon Rapids is known for its commitment to community and preserving its unique heritage while embracing the future.

Local Attractions in Coon Rapids, IA

Whiterock Conservancy - A large, non-profit land trust offering outdoor recreational activities and conservation education.

Garst Farm Resorts - Historical farm site known for hosting Soviet Premier Nikita Khrushchev during the Cold War.

Middle Raccoon River - Popular for fishing, canoeing, and scenic views along its banks.

Coon Rapids-Bayard School Forest - A managed forest area used for educational purposes and nature walks.

Downtown Historical District - Features a variety of shops and historical buildings, reflecting the city's rich heritage.


The Economy of Coon Rapids, IA

The economy of Coon Rapids is primarily driven by agriculture, reflecting its location in one of Iowa's most fertile farming areas. The city has also diversified its economic base by incorporating small manufacturing, retail, and service industries. Local businesses benefit from the community's strategic focus on sustainable development and support for entrepreneurial ventures.
